Incorrect Training Techniques



Incorrect training strategies can dramatically contribute to pain in the back and injuries. When you lift heavy items, remember to bend your knees and use your legs to lift, rather than relying upon your back muscles. Avoid twisting your body while training and keep the things close to your body to minimize strain on your back. It's critical to preserve a straight back and avoid rounding your shoulders while raising to prevent unneeded stress on your back.

Constantly assess the weight of the things prior to raising it. If it's as well hefty, request help or usage devices like a dolly or cart to carry it safely.

Remember to take breaks during lifting jobs to offer your back muscles a possibility to rest and protect against overexertion. By executing correct training methods, you can prevent pain in the back and decrease the risk of injuries, ensuring your back stays healthy and balanced and solid for the long term.

Absence of Regular Workout and Stretching



A less active way of living devoid of normal workout and stretching can dramatically add to pain in the back and discomfort. When you do not participate in physical activity, your muscular tissues become weak and inflexible, causing inadequate pose and enhanced pressure on your back. Regular exercise aids reinforce the muscular tissues that support your spinal column, enhancing stability and lowering the threat of back pain. Including stretching right into your regimen can likewise boost adaptability, stopping tightness and pain in your back muscles.

To prevent back pain brought on by an absence of exercise and extending, go for at the very least 30 minutes of modest exercise most days of the week. Consist of exercises that target your core muscles, as a solid core can aid minimize pressure on your back.


In addition, take breaks to extend and move throughout the day, particularly if you have a desk work.
